Since 1882, Dow Jones has been finding new ways to bring information to the world's top business entities. Beginning as a niche news agency in an obscure Wall Street basement, Dow Jones has grown to be a worldwide news and information powerhouse, with prestigious brands including The Wall Street Journal, Dow Jones Newswires, Factiva, Barron's, MarketWatch and Financial News.

Job Description OPIS, a Dow Jones company, provides price transparency across the global fuel supply chain. The OPIS Cloud Operations team supports the OPIS business by ensuring overall operational performance, security, and reliability of OPIS’ cloud environments. The Senior Database Administrator works closely with OPIS product teams to administer MS SQL and IBM DB2 databases, enforce compliance, and support continuous operation and high availability.

You Will

Oversee and manage OPIS database systems (MS SQL and IBM DB2) and their infrastructure to ensure optimal performance, availability, and security.

Manage database and database objects design, configuration, and testing activities to ensure the performance of the databases in support of OPIS applications from development to production.

Monitor system health, database availability and performance, diagnose and resolve technical issues, resolve database performance and capacity issues, replication and other distributed data issues, and implement proactive measures to prevent disruptions.

Plan and execute database system housekeeping, such as tuning, indexing, etc. and upgrades, data migration, and security patches.

Design database backup, archiving, and storage strategy. Develop and implement OPIS database system disaster recovery plans and procedures.

Collaborate with OPIS product teams to leverage our database systems in order to design optimal solutions, and support the development and deployment of new systems and products.

Provide advanced database technical support and offer timely and effective solutions to complex challenges.

Create and maintain database standards and policies and comprehensive documentation for database system configurations, processes, and procedures using Atlassian Confluence and Azure DevOps.

You Have

BS in Computer Science, Information Technology, Information Systems, or related field preferred with 4 years of relevant experience, or 7 years of relevant experience.

Proven expertise in administering Microsoft SQL Server and IBM DB2 databases, as well as highly available database technologies (Microsoft Replication, Log Shipping, Mirroring, Failover Clustering, IBM DB2 HADR).

Proven experience administering Linux and Windows Server operating systems, and AWS cloud services.

Strong understanding of cloud database technologies, cloud computing concepts, and networking protocols.

Database Certifications (SQL Server, DB2) preferred.

Programming and Automation Experience (SQL Scripting, PowerShell, Python, etc.).
